If you follow the instructions in the >>>>> falcon/trunk/README you should not have to make any edits to build.xml >>>>> assuming your directory tree looks like it does in svn. >>>>> >>>>> Before trying to build Falcon, you must: >>>>> >>>>> 1. Build the the "develop" branch of the SDK at >>>>> incubator/flex/sdk/branches/develop by doing 'ant main'. >>>>> See the README there for instructions. >>>>> >>>>> 2. Set the environment variables JAVA_HOME, ANT_HOME, and >>>>> PLAYERGLOBAL_HOME as when building the SDK. >>>>> >>>>> 3. Set the environment variable JFLEX_JAR to point to the JAR file for >>>>> JFlex 1.4.3. >>>>> >>>>> sdk.branch is set to <property name="sdk.branch" >>>>> value="${compiler}/../../../sdk/branches/develop"/>.
